How To Fix Your Dead Phone

Jaro 22. October 2007 :: , , , ,

You wanted to update your phone’s firmware but the phone died in the middle of the process. It happens quite often. People either don’t follow the recommendations (i.e. have your battery fully charged) or there really is something wrong with the update itself. The best thing you can do in this situation is to contact the closest Nokia Care point. They should repair it free of charge if your phone is still under guarantee. However this is not always an option. There are not that many Nokia Care points, especially not outside Europe.

Send your phone to iUnlock

I’ve heard good things about the guys from iUnlock. They are located in Boston and for certain fee they will flash your phone with new firmware. Price depends on the model and its condition. If it’s completely dead you’ll have to pay $5 extra. Flashing of Nokia E50 will cost you $35. I think that $35 is the price if you are located within the US.

Broken Mobile Phone

One of the readers from Germany contacted me a couple of weeks ago to let me know that iUnlock reflashed his phone for a total cost of $46. It might seem expensive but if your phone is completely dead you have only two options – throw it away or have it repaired for $30 – $50.

How does it work

First you have to register on iunlock.com. Log in to your account and find the model you own. Fill the form at the bottom you’ll be taken to the checkout page. After you make the payment you’ll receive an invoice. Send the invoice together with your phone to iUnlock. Your phone should be repaired in a couple of days (for more details check out their FAQ page). It goes without saying that by having your device flashed you lose your guarantee.
